Rebel camps are NPC armies randomly spawning on the world map. Rally your house allies and defeat them for loot and glory.

  • Exile fortresses come in 20 levels. The higher the level, the greater the reward upon victory.
  • Use combinations of suitable troop types and unite with more House members to increase your chance of victory.
  • Attacking fortresses costs rally commands. If you don't have any rally commands, you can still join rallies, but you will not receive rewards upon victory:
  • If you fail a rally (get defeated), the rally command is spent.
  • If you cancel the rally (manually by a user or automatically when the fortress disappears), the rally command is restored when your troops return home.

Tips[edit | edit source]

  • Exile fortresses expire ~2 minutes before server time midnight. Don't be surprised if your rally gets disbanded.
  • Higher-level fortresses usually spawn around high-star castles.
  • A general rule of thumb: If you score a complete victory against a certain level, you're probably ready for the next higher level fortress.
  • Sometimes, reducing the number of lower-level troops (just send 1 troop) allows your rally to win, even if this reduces the total troops in your rally. See 1111.

Rewards[edit | edit source]

Additionally, as a rare reward, you can receive elite fortress intel or abandoned ranger castle intel from exile fortresses. The level of the elite fortress intel depends on the level of the exile that you defeat. There's also a minimum castle level required to be eligible for the highest-level intel.

Exile fortress Elite fortress intel level ARC intel level
1-4 N/A N/A
5 3 N/A
6 5 N/A
7 7 1
8 9 2
9 10 3
10-14 15 4
15-19 20 5
20 25 10
